Transaction 65cf76299381b5f7bedff23677e678ea5013e443aee9b3f968818b0533060ee2

12 Input
2 Outputs
  • 65cf76299381b5f7bedff23677e678ea5013e443aee9b3f968818b0533060ee2:0
  • value  172872405
    address  36oTb5mAQ4XnvkyLrhaPmsNbXRVTZnLsWh
  • 65cf76299381b5f7bedff23677e678ea5013e443aee9b3f968818b0533060ee2:1
  • value  1178841858
    address  3Beh1tuP3bbW8bfZP2SzTwpeoeS2ZWUUeJ